In the realm of amateur astronomy, the search for a wide field of view (FOV) eyepiece is a common pursuit. Enter the Explore Scientific 82° Ultra Wide Field eyepieces, a series that stands out from the crowd with its exceptional features.

For those who have been using Plossls, the difference is noticeable. While Plossls offer fairly sharp images for their price, their apparent field of view is only 52°. In contrast, the Explore Scientific 8.2o eyepieces offer an 82° apparent field of view, making them an ultra wide eyepiece. This ultra-wide FOV allows for a more immersive and panoramic sky view, enabling observers to see more of the night sky at once.

The superiority of the Explore Scientific eyepieces extends beyond their FOV. These eyepieces are noted for their high optical quality, incorporating advanced multi-element designs with premium glass and coatings. This leads to sharp, bright images with minimal chromatic aberration and edge distortions even at the wide edges of the field of view.

One of the key advantages of the 82° Ultra Wide Field eyepieces is their generous eye relief. With around 17-20 mm, these eyepieces are advantageous for eyeglass wearers and comfortable for long observing sessions. This is typically more than many other wide field eyepieces that may offer shorter eye relief.

The Explore Scientific 82° Ultra Wide Field series also boasts waterproof construction, purged with argon gas to prevent moisture from intruding and producing fogging or internal growth of mold and fungus. They also come with an eyecup, which helps position the eye properly on the eyepiece and block stray light.

In comparison to other wide field eyepieces on the market, the Explore Scientific 82° Ultra Wide Field series stands out by delivering a very wide viewing angle, superior optical clarity with advanced coatings and glass, and longer eye relief for comfort. These features combine to give amateur astronomers a premium visual experience that is both immersive and comfortable for extended use.

Registering an ES 8.2o eyepiece within sixty days of purchase through Explore Scientific's website converts the one-year warranty into an Explore Star extended life warranty, a lifetime, transferable warranty that covers all accidents or damages.

The Explore Scientific 82o eyepiece is better corrected for use in lower focal ratio scopes, and does not show significant distortion or aberration when used with shorter focal ratio telescopes. It also performs well in high focal ratio scopes. The extended eye relief of the ES 8.2o eyepieces makes them more comfortable to use, especially for those who wear glasses.
